What is Domain Name? How to Choose Domain Name for Beginners in 2022

What is Domain Name

What is Domain Name? It is the most recommended question comes in beginner’s mind. If you are looking to make a career in digital marketing, you must have a website.

To make a website, You must have a domain name and host. So it is very important for beginners to know what is domain name and how it works in detail.

What is Domain Name?

In the simplest way, we can call the domain name as “Web Address”. Now, what is the web address? it is an address that you search on the browser’s address bar to look out own or anyone’s website.

Domain Name

In other words, I can say that the domain name is an identification of your website.

The internet is a huge network of computers which are connected to cables. Through IP address, each computer can communicate with other computers because every computer has its own IP address.

IP addresses are a series of numbers (for example, which are difficult to remember for humans. Just imagine how many numbers or IP addresses you can remember? Not so much right!!

To make it easier, the domain name is developed. Let say if you want to visit someone’s or own website, you do not have to remember a series of numbers but you just have to remember the domain name. A domain name is easy to remember for everyone.

Now you do not have to worry about remembering IP addresses because domain names come in the market. The domain name could be anything like a combination of numbers and letters or just letters or just a word. For example, https://dmody.com

A web domain name ends with 2 to 3 characters names such as .in, .com, .org, etc after all it depends on the country.

I hope beginners get the idea about what is domain name.

How does a domain name work?

This is the 2nd most question that beginners have in their minds. Let’s check it out how a domain name works.

It is very easy to understand. Let’s take an example, we all know that a laptop has a hard drive that you can store your documents, songs, movies, and more, the same thing each website has a server or you can say, host. And it is connected with the specific IP of the hosting server.

Let’s take a look at the browser. Let say when you enter a domain name on the address bar of your browser, the name itself connected with a specific IP address which is connected to Domain Name Server (DNS).

Now this DNS server is search for a domain name server that is controlled by the hosting company. This hosting company sends a request to the web server where your website is already stored.

At last, this web server pulls the web page and all data will appear in the browser. I hope you guys understand how a domain name works.

How to choose a Domain Name – For Beginners

There are few points to keep in mind before to choose a domain name.

  1. The domain name must be according to your interested niche.
  2. The domain name should be very easy to remember for everyone.
  3. Keep the domain name easy to speak like everyone can pronounce easily.
  4. Try to keep the domain name completely different than others.
  5. Never keep symbols on your domain name.
  6. Try to avoid numbers in the domain name.
  7. Keep your domain name short as possible as you can.

Once you decide your domain name, check availability on websites like godaddy.com, namecheap.com, and more.

Once you got availability, just register it and purchase it. The Domain name costs some around $10 to $15 per year.

How to Register a Domain Name step by step?

According to me, I can say that a domain name is an important part of website. If you want to run an online business, you can imagine how a domain name is important for you according to your niche.

Here are few things that I want to discuss.

First, you must think about the domain names according to your niche. It is very important as we are doing the SEO part.

Second, you must have debit or credit card for payment.

Third, you have to go to the website which offers domain name like godaddy.com, namecheap.com, domain.com, bigrock.in, etc and register over there.

There are paid top domain websites are available which is as follow:

Best Domain Registrars – Buy Domain Name

Best Domain Registrars:

1. Godaddy.com

2. Namecheap.com

3. Bigrock.in

4. Domain.com

5. Name.com

6. Buydomains.com

Basically, a domain name costs $9 to $15 per year. It depends on different kind of company.

Let’s understand this with an example of Namecheap website for domain name.

Step 1: You have to go to website https://namecheap.com/

Step 2: Search here your domain name availability. If is it available then buy it.

Here I am showing you my example, devansh123.com


How to Register a Domain Name for Free?

Now, I want to show you how to register a domain name for free step by step.

Now we will look for some websites that offer you free domains + hosting (Combo).

You can check this link out about deep knowledge of what is web hosting and types of web hosting.

Best hosting for wordpress:

Best Hosting For WordPress:
1. Bluehost.com

2. Greengeeks.com

3. Hostinger.com

4. Hostgator.com

5. A2hosting.com

6. Hostgator.com

7. Siteground.com

Let’s see with an example with www.Bluehost.com

Step 1: You need to go to the Bluehost website that is www.bluehost.com and you will see the page like this


Now click on “Get Started” button.

Step 2: When you click on the get started button, the next page appears and on this page you have to choose a plan.


In this plan, you are getting FREE Domain + Hosting. Basically, I can say that you will get a combo.

Step 3: Let say I select a Basic plan. After click on the “Select” button, the next page will look like this


Now you need to write down your domain name in that box and make sure it relevant to your niche. Also, keep in mind that you make sure you select the .com extension because it is more valuable than others.

Now click on “Next” button.

Step 4: After clicking on the next button the next page will appear and you need to fill all information and choose a plan like if you want for 1 year, 2 years, or 3 years.


After select plan you just have to submit it.

Step 5: After submission, the payment methods will appear. Pay for it and you are good to go. Now you will receive an email and this email includes all the information.

If you follow all these steps you will get FREE Domain + Hosting. And you are good to go to design your website.

You can check domain name availability here.

(If you have adblocker, just remove it for a while)

Check Expired Domain Name availability

People buy a domain name for 1 year and for any kind of reason he/she is not able to renew or stop renew that domain. So this domain considers as an expired domain.

There are a lot of expired domain available.

Click here to check expire domain availability.

How to Buy a Domain Name?

Buy Domain Name

How to buy a domain name that I already discuss in how to register a domain name.

To buy a domain name we have 2 options like:

Option 1: Simply go to those website who offers you to purchase domain name like

  1. Godaddy.com
  2. Namecheap.com
  3. Bigrock.in
  4. Domain.com
  5. Name.com
  6. Buydomains.com

From above websites, you can buy your desire domain name.

Option 2: You are getting free domain here, if you buy hosting from below websites.

  1. Bluehost.com
  2. Greengeeks.com
  3. Hostinger.com
  4. Hostgator.com
  5. A2hosting.com
  6. Hostgator.com
  7. Siteground.com

How to Transfer a Domain Name?

You might have a question like once I buy a domain name, can I transfer it? The answer is YES. A domain name can be transferred from one registrar to another.

It is so simple. You just have to go to that website, where you want to transfer your domain name. Apply over there. That’s all.

However, my suggestion is you do not need to transfer your domain name until you are not satisfied with it. If you feel that now I need to transfer then go for it.

But there a rule that you need to follow.

Once you purchased your domain name, you can not transfer it within 60 days from the registration date. After 60 days, you are allowed to transfer.

Some of the domain registrars do not charge extra for domain transfer. However, some of them are charged it so you need to be careful about it.

You can transfer a domain name from any of the domain registrars and it will take time approx 4 to 7 days to complete all the process. If you get any trouble, customer service is always there for you.

What is a Subdomain?

Basically, the subdomain is the domain that comes under your main domain. Or you can say that it an additional part of the main domain.

In other words, subdomain comes before your main domain.

For example,

dmody.com is my main domain. (dmody is my main domain & .com is my extension.)


digital.dmody.com is my subdomain. (digital is my subdomain.)

Here you can put any name for your subdomain. However, it should be easy to remember.

I hope you got idea of what is a subdomain.

Difference Between Domain Vs Subdomain


Domains are used for website names. Each website contains an IP address and it comes in numbers only which is hard to remember.

To make it easy to remember, the domain name is developed. You can put any name like dmody.com Also, you can do a combination of letters and numbers.


Subdomains are the additional part of your main domain and it comes before your main domain and extension.

For example, digital.dmody.com – digital is my subdomain. Here you can put any name for your subdomain. But make sure it is easy to remember for everyone.

You do not have to pay extra for subdomain as you have main domain.

Types of Domain Name

Types of Domain

There are different types of domain name available. Let’s check it out.

We all know that .com extension is very famous and easily comes to mouth when you speak.

Top Level Domain (TLD):

There are so many top level domain is available but we see few of them.

Top Level Domain (TLD):

(1) .com - Commercial

(2) .edu - Education

(3) .net - Network

(4) .tech - Technology

(5) .biz - Business

(6) .org - Organization

(7) .gov - Government

There are two types Top Level Domain.

  1. Generic Top Level Domain (gTLD)
  2. Country Code Top Level Domain (ccTLD)

Generic Top Level Domain (gTLD)

Generic Top Level Domain is the top most level domain which is a plan for a particular use. For example, the .edu extension is used for education purposes.

Generic Top Level Domain (gTLD):

(1) .edu - Education

(2) .mil - Military

(3) .gov - Government

(4) .org - Organization

(5) .net - Network 

This domain names can register by anyone and anywhere in the world.

Country Code Top Level Domain (ccTLD)

Basically, the Country Code Top Level Domain comes in two letters. It is totally based on international country codes.

Country Code Top Level Domain (ccTLD):

(1) .in - India

(2) .us - United States

(3) .uk - United Kingdom

(4) .br - Brazil

(5) .jp - Japan

(6) .de - Germany

Second Level Domain:

Sometimes may be you guys see these type of domains (which is including country code).

Let’s tak example of United Kingdom (UK).

Second Level Domain:

(1) .co.uk - British company use

(2) .gov.uk - Use for government institutions

(3) .ac.uk - used by academic institutions and universities


If you are a beginner and you are looking to make a career in digital marketing, you must have a domain and host for that. In short, you must have a website to do practical work and experience on it.

In this blog, I tried my best to explain everything about the domain from basic to advanced levels.

I hope you got knowledge of what is a domain name, how a domain name works, how to choose a domain name for beginners, how to register a domain name step by step, How to buy a domain name, how to transfer the domain name.

Also, I discussed about subdomain like what is subdomain, domain vs subdomain.

And important point I discussed that is different types of domain name.

In my opinion, domain name is the important part of website as well as SEO part.

So my request to everyone is, take your time to choose domain name according to your niche.


1. What is domain name with example?

Ans: Domain name is nothing but Web Address. In other words, I can say that the
domain name is an identification of your website. For example https://digitkivisit.com
2. How to come up with a domain name?

Ans: You can check your domain name in different website. For example: search for 
https://namecheap.com and you can put your domain name over there and make 
sure it is it available or not.
3. What is a valid domain name?

Ans: Domain name always end up with suffix like .com. You can add numbers and
 characters on it.
4. How much should I pay for domain name?

Ans: Well, it depends on extension and company as well. We need to check out regularly 
for best price. I prefer to go with https://namecheap.com. You can see best deal on it.

I hope you enjoy this article about What is Domain Name.

I need favor from you guys that is comment below the box and do let me know how’s it.

If you have any doubts, you know you can reach me on the contact us page.

Thank you.

All the best!!

To get detail information about hosting then Ping for what is web hosting and how it works?

Devansh Mody

I am Digital marketing Blogger. Sharing knowledge about digital marketing, hosting, domains, tools, plugins etc.

This Post Has 45 Comments

  1. Bloggerbala

    I love you writing. Neat clean and prominently described.

  2. Hari

    This is awesome… Everything from the scratch has explained nicely.. good going..

  3. Rita

    Thanks for info. Got knowledge from here.. Keep it up

  4. Nirav

    Nice..one.. But put some attractive graphix on it.. 👍

  5. jenish

    fantastic blog…keep it up…

  6. Abhi

    That is really helpful for me.
    Thank you very much for sharing such an important information.

  7. Harshalkumar KishorbhaI Patel

    Good Explanation…Keep it up!

  8. Dhruvi Patel

    This is the best adviser for the beginners.thank you so much for this article.

    1. Arun Kumar

      Very informative 👏
      Learned some new things from this article. Thank you

  9. Khushboo

    Useful and very helpful information…

  10. Arpit Mody

    All the topic cover sharp so anyone easily understand and do practicaly easily.. It is very useful for all beginners like me to know about what is domain and subdomain… After reading this I clear about this it is useful for that person who interest in digital marketing …..

  11. Arpit Mody

    It is useful for all the beginner who interest in digital marketing …
    Every topic explain very sharp and nicely so any one easily do it .. and all the topic covered releated to domain and subdomain …

    Thank you😊😊

  12. Arpit Mody

    It is useful for all the beginner who interest in digital marketing …
    Every topic explain very sharp and nicely so any one easily do it .. and all the topic covered releated to domain and subdomain …

    Good one 😊😊

  13. Arpit Mody

    It is very useful for all the beginners who interest in digital marketing… Every topic explain very sharp and nicely so any one easily understand …all the topic related to domain and subdomain cover nicely…

    Good one

  14. Arpit Mody

    It is very useful for all the beginners who interest in digital marketing… Every topic explain very sharp and nicely so any one easily understand …all the topic related to domain and subdomain cover nicely…

    Good one

  15. Heet Vadiya

    Very good explanation 🙂

  16. Kiran Solanki

    One can easily understand basics,
    Best for a personlike me who is always hungry for detail informations.

    Please keep it up
    Thank you for good content

  17. Radhika Thakrar

    Nice content 👍

  18. Radhika Thakrar

    Nice content 👍

  19. Khyati Mody

    Very nice explanation 👌👌
    Keep it up 😊

  20. Rahul padhiyar

    Good work

  21. Preet kumar

    Oh my god, well explained in details!! Loved it! 🎀🎀🎀🎀

  22. Jasvinder

    very well explained 👍🏼👍🏼👍🏼

  23. Dhaivat Raval

    Awesome work.

  24. Ravi Teja

    Clearly explained.
    Beginners can easily understand.
    Nice article

  25. Kunal

    All the informatios are very clear to understand easily and share to others also.
    Best thing is it’s very simple to get the information from it.

  26. Rita

    Basics to advanced knowledge you provide. Thank you so much

    1. Mitesh Pardeshi

      Very Good information provided for domain.
      Please keep posting such good content.

  27. Devraj

    It’s help,me

  28. Devraj

    Thanks for helping me

  29. Naresh

    Thanks for sharing this knowledge.. About domains. Basic to advanced

  30. Neel

    Good information provid about domain it’s helpful.

  31. Janki parekh

    Very useful information for beginners..very interesting to read… keep it up… waiting for new blog…. thanks for information

  32. Kiran Solanki

    Your knowledge is very deep on this
    Thanks for sharing this with us.

  33. Harish

    Great post, very useful for me.

    1. Devansh Mody

      Thank you buddy, you can get more knowledge from other blogs too..

Leave a Reply